[nginx] allow 127.0.0.1; ne fonctionne plus (résolu)

Applications, problèmes de configuration réseau
ignace72
yeomen
Messages : 285
Inscription : ven. 09 sept. 2011, 14:21

[nginx] allow 127.0.0.1; ne fonctionne plus (résolu)

Message par ignace72 » jeu. 20 sept. 2018, 22:52

Salut à tous
pour bloquer une page et un répertoire quand la requête vient de l’extérieur j'utilisais :

Code : Tout sélectionner

#	location ^~ /wp-admin {
#		root	/srv/http;
#		allow	127.0.0.1;
#		deny	all;
#		fastcgi_pass	unix:/run/php-fpm/php-fpm.sock;
#		fastcgi_index	index.php;
#		include        fastcgi.conf;
#	}
et

Code : Tout sélectionner

#	location = /wp-login.php {
#		root	/srv/http;
#		allow	127.0.0.1;
#		deny	all;
#		fastcgi_pass	unix:/run/php-fpm/php-fpm.sock;
#		fastcgi_index	index.php;
#		include        fastcgi.conf;
#	}
(C'est commenté le temps que je trouve la solution).

Depuis aujourd'hui, j'ai une erreur 403 alors que je suis toujours depuis 127.0.0.1

Si quelqu'un a une idée de pourquoi ça ne fonctionne plus ?
Merci
Dernière modification par ignace72 le ven. 21 sept. 2018, 14:14, modifié 1 fois.
AMD Phenom II X6 1100T, 16 Go de ram DDR3, bluetooth, Wifi, USB3, S-ATA 3
21,5" LCD tn (16/9) x2 sur AMD HD 7750 fanless (pilote libre).
XFce et BÉPO.
Site perso : https://ignace72.eu

Backtoback
yeomen
Messages : 256
Inscription : jeu. 26 avr. 2012, 23:33
Contact :

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par Backtoback » ven. 21 sept. 2018, 00:32

Bonjour,

quelle est ta version de php?
$ php --version

Cordialement

ignace72
yeomen
Messages : 285
Inscription : ven. 09 sept. 2011, 14:21

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par ignace72 » ven. 21 sept. 2018, 09:56

bonjour.
C'est la version 7.2.10
AMD Phenom II X6 1100T, 16 Go de ram DDR3, bluetooth, Wifi, USB3, S-ATA 3
21,5" LCD tn (16/9) x2 sur AMD HD 7750 fanless (pilote libre).
XFce et BÉPO.
Site perso : https://ignace72.eu

benjarobin
Maître du Kyudo
Messages : 15476
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par benjarobin » ven. 21 sept. 2018, 10:25

Bonjour,
Il faudrait voir ce qui est ajouté dans access_log / error_log quand tu tentes d'accéder à la page. je ne vois pas comment cela pourrais être lié à php. C'est du 100% nginx. A moins que cela ne soit pas une erreur 403 de nginx mais celle du site... Pour cela il faudrait voir le contenu affiché.
Zsh | KDE | PC fixe : core i7, carte nvidia | Portable : Asus ul80vt
Titre d'un sujet : [Thème] Sujet (état)

ignace72
yeomen
Messages : 285
Inscription : ven. 09 sept. 2011, 14:21

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par ignace72 » ven. 21 sept. 2018, 11:47

Bonjour.
pour mon error.log :

Code : Tout sélectionner

2018/09/21 09:37:20 [error] 5780#5780: *1 access forbidden by rule, client: ::1, server: localhost, request: "GET /wp-login.php HTTP/2.0", host: "ignace72.eu"
et pour mon access.log ça donne :

Code : Tout sélectionner

::1 - - [21/Sep/2018:09:37:20 +0000] "GET /wp-login.php HTTP/2.0" 403 310 "-" "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/69.0.3497.100 Safari/537.36"
Pour voir ce que ça donne https://ignace72.eu/wp-login.php.
AMD Phenom II X6 1100T, 16 Go de ram DDR3, bluetooth, Wifi, USB3, S-ATA 3
21,5" LCD tn (16/9) x2 sur AMD HD 7750 fanless (pilote libre).
XFce et BÉPO.
Site perso : https://ignace72.eu

benjarobin
Maître du Kyudo
Messages : 15476
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par benjarobin » ven. 21 sept. 2018, 13:09

Ajoute

Code : Tout sélectionner

allow ::1;
Zsh | KDE | PC fixe : core i7, carte nvidia | Portable : Asus ul80vt
Titre d'un sujet : [Thème] Sujet (état)

ignace72
yeomen
Messages : 285
Inscription : ven. 09 sept. 2011, 14:21

Re: [nginx] allow 127.0.0.1; ne fonctionne plus

Message par ignace72 » ven. 21 sept. 2018, 14:13

Merci, ça fonctionne parfaitement.
AMD Phenom II X6 1100T, 16 Go de ram DDR3, bluetooth, Wifi, USB3, S-ATA 3
21,5" LCD tn (16/9) x2 sur AMD HD 7750 fanless (pilote libre).
XFce et BÉPO.
Site perso : https://ignace72.eu

Répondre